U.S., March 8 -- ClinicalTrials.gov registry received information related to the study (NCT06299527) titled 'Clinical Outcomes of Asynchronous Telerehabilitation Are Equivalent to Synchronous Telerehabilitation in Patients With Fibromyalgia: a Randomized Control Study' on March 1.

Brief Summary: Sixty-six FMS patients received the same exercise program for 8 weeks and divided, synchronous (n: 33), asynchronous (n: 33).
